Перейти к содержимому
Калькуляторы

SNR Flasher: Программа прошивки устройств SNR-ERD теперь для linux

http://data.nag.ru/SNR%20ERD/Programs/SNR_Flasher

 

Использование: Output/ubuntu/SNR_Flasher file.hex ERD_IP

где

ERD_IP - IPv4 адрес ERD device. example: 192.168.15.20

file.hex - файл прошивки устройства

 

Проверено на linux i386

 

Поддерживаемые устройства:

SNR-ERD-2.3

SNR-ERD-3.2

SNR-ERD-3S

SNR-ERD-GSM-1.0

SNR-ERD-GSM-1.1

Octopus-GSM (SNR-GSM-SERIAL-1.2)

Octopus-GSM (SNR-GSM-SERIAL-1.1)

SNR-ERD-COUNTER-1.0

SNR-ERD-COUNTER-1.1

 

 

Отпишитесь, кто попробует

Изменено пользователем Victor Pestov

Поделиться сообщением


Ссылка на сообщение
Поделиться на других сайтах

Попробовал.

Не работает.

 

$ snmpwalk -v1 -c public 10.4.4.102
SNMPv2-MIB::sysDescr.0 = STRING: Fmv_6.5
SNMPv2-MIB::sysObjectID.0 = OID: SNMPv2-SMI::enterprises.40418.2.2
SNMPv2-MIB::sysName.0 = STRING: SNR
IF-MIB::ifIndex.0 = INTEGER: 1
IF-MIB::ifPhysAddress.0 = STRING: f8:f0:82:2:11:99
IP-MIB::ipAdEntAddr.0 = IpAddress: 10.4.4.102
$ ./SNR_Flasher firmware_SNR-ERD-2.3.hex 10.4.4.102
argv[1] firmware_SNR-ERD-2.3.hex
argv[2] 10.4.4.102
Set ip: 10.4.4.102
File loaded 27548 bytes
Work with: 10.4.4.102
Send reboot...OK
Look ERD boot loader.....Faild
Entering programming mode.....Faild
Query flash block size.....FaildLen: -1
Set address to start......Faild
Get flash blockFloating point exception

 

Поделиться сообщением


Ссылка на сообщение
Поделиться на других сайтах
В 16.02.2018 в 20:14, LynxChaus сказал:

Попробовал.

Не работает.

 


$ snmpwalk -v1 -c public 10.4.4.102
SNMPv2-MIB::sysDescr.0 = STRING: Fmv_6.5
SNMPv2-MIB::sysObjectID.0 = OID: SNMPv2-SMI::enterprises.40418.2.2
SNMPv2-MIB::sysName.0 = STRING: SNR
IF-MIB::ifIndex.0 = INTEGER: 1
IF-MIB::ifPhysAddress.0 = STRING: f8:f0:82:2:11:99
IP-MIB::ipAdEntAddr.0 = IpAddress: 10.4.4.102

$ ./SNR_Flasher firmware_SNR-ERD-2.3.hex 10.4.4.102
argv[1] firmware_SNR-ERD-2.3.hex
argv[2] 10.4.4.102
Set ip: 10.4.4.102
File loaded 27548 bytes
Work with: 10.4.4.102
Send reboot...OK
Look ERD boot loader.....Faild
Entering programming mode.....Faild
Query flash block size.....FaildLen: -1
Set address to start......Faild
Get flash blockFloating point exception

 

При этом есть пинг до устройства? Какое время ответа?

Приложите, пожалуйста, trace лог

Поделиться сообщением


Ссылка на сообщение
Поделиться на других сайтах
3 hours ago, Victor Pestov said:

При этом есть пинг до устройства?

Был до запуска прошивальщика. Теперь - нет.

 

3 hours ago, Victor Pestov said:

Какое время ответа?

~50ms

3 hours ago, Victor Pestov said:

trace лог

trace чего?

 

Поделиться сообщением


Ссылка на сообщение
Поделиться на других сайтах
В 16.02.2018 в 20:14, LynxChaus сказал:

Попробовал.

Не работает.

 


$ snmpwalk -v1 -c public 10.4.4.102
SNMPv2-MIB::sysDescr.0 = STRING: Fmv_6.5
SNMPv2-MIB::sysObjectID.0 = OID: SNMPv2-SMI::enterprises.40418.2.2
SNMPv2-MIB::sysName.0 = STRING: SNR
IF-MIB::ifIndex.0 = INTEGER: 1
IF-MIB::ifPhysAddress.0 = STRING: f8:f0:82:2:11:99
IP-MIB::ipAdEntAddr.0 = IpAddress: 10.4.4.102

$ ./SNR_Flasher firmware_SNR-ERD-2.3.hex 10.4.4.102
argv[1] firmware_SNR-ERD-2.3.hex
argv[2] 10.4.4.102
Set ip: 10.4.4.102
File loaded 27548 bytes
Work with: 10.4.4.102
Send reboot...OK
Look ERD boot loader.....Faild
Entering programming mode.....Faild
Query flash block size.....FaildLen: -1
Set address to start......Faild
Get flash blockFloating point exception

 

Интересует traceroute до устройства 10.4.4.102

 

Судя по логу программатор не смог связаться с устройством ( Look ERD boot loader.....Faild ) После того как отправил в перезагрузку (Send reboot...OK)

 

Этот лог это единственный запуск программатора, или были еще запуски?

как предположение, что этот лог уже после появления проблем с устройством, т.к. в логе нет информации даже о начале загрузке прошивки  в само устройство

 

Поделиться сообщением


Ссылка на сообщение
Поделиться на других сайтах

Там 5 хопов. Какое это отношение имеет к работе софта?

 

5 hours ago, seprize said:

После того как отправил в перезагрузку (Send reboot...OK)

Ага. В ребут то оно уходит. А потом еще с пару суток не пингуется.

 

5 hours ago, seprize said:

Этот лог это единственный запуск программатора, или были еще запуски?

Не в курсе, я запускал только один раз.

Сразу скажу, железка физически километрах в 200 от меня и на светодиодики посмотреть возможности нет. Как и дернуть её по питанию.

 

Поделиться сообщением


Ссылка на сообщение
Поделиться на других сайтах

Создайте аккаунт или войдите в него для комментирования

Вы должны быть пользователем, чтобы оставить комментарий

Создать аккаунт

Зарегистрируйтесь для получения аккаунта. Это просто!

Зарегистрировать аккаунт

Войти

Уже зарегистрированы? Войдите здесь.

Войти сейчас